The anti-cancer effects of Extract (AE) on A549 cells - The role of Bcl-2 family protein on the AE-induced apoptosis -
Nam ye-Seon

Cho Min-Kyung
Abstract
Objective: The aim of this study is to evaluate anti-cancer effects of Extract (AE) on human lung cancer A549 cells.

Method: The apoptotic activities and cell growth arrest activities of AE were measured using 3-[4,5-dimethyl-thiazol-2-yl]-2,5-diphenyltetrazolium bromide (MTT) assay. The molecules involved in apoptotic process were assessed by western blotting.

Result: Treatment of AE potently reduced cell viability in a dose-dependent manner in A549 cells. AE (100-500 ) resulted in apoptosis via activation of caspase 9 following PARP cleavage in a time-and dose-dependent manner. The levels of Bax and Bad levels were increased by AE with a concomitant decrease of Bcl-xL. In addition, AE at the low dose (30 ) significantly inhibited cell growth in the presence of serum.

Conclusion: AE has the potential as a therapeutic agent against lung cancer.
